Lawn Mowing Patterns : How to Create Artistic Designs for Your Lawn

When it comes to lawn maintenance, mowing is a crucial task. But did you know that you can make your lawn look more visually appealing by creating artistic mowing patterns? By using different techniques and angles, you can turn your boring lawn into a work of art. In this article, we will discuss how you can create various lawn mowing patterns that will elevate the appearance of your lawn.

Mowing Techniques

The first step in creating lawn mowing patterns is to choose the right technique. There are several techniques that you can use, including:

  1. Straight Lines: This technique involves mowing straight lines across your lawn. It's simple but effective, and it can create an organized and neat look for your lawn. You can use this technique to create a checkerboard pattern, which is perfect for a more formal setting.
  2. Diagonal Lines: This technique involves mowing diagonal lines across your lawn. It's similar to the straight line technique, but it adds a bit more visual interest. You can use this technique to create a diamond pattern, which looks great on larger lawns.
  3. Circular Patterns: This technique involves mowing circular patterns on your lawn. It's a bit more challenging than the straight and diagonal line techniques, but it creates a beautiful and intricate design. You can use this technique to create a spiral pattern, which is perfect for a whimsical and playful look.
  4. Striping: This technique involves mowing in alternating directions to create stripes on your lawn. It's a bit more time-consuming than the other techniques, but it creates a stunning effect. You can use this technique to create a sunburst pattern, which is perfect for a bold and modern look.

Angles

The angle at which you mow your lawn can also affect the overall look of the pattern. Here are some tips for using angles to create different effects:

  • Straight On: Mowing straight on creates a uniform look that is perfect for simple patterns like straight lines or stripes.
  • 45-Degree Angle: Mowing at a 45-degree angle creates a more textured look that works well with diagonal lines or circular patterns.
  • Curved: Mowing in a curved pattern creates a softer and more organic look that is perfect for spiral patterns or circular designs.

Tips and Tricks

Creating lawn mowing patterns can be tricky, especially if you're new to it. Here are some tips to help you get started:

  • Plan Ahead: Before you start mowing, plan out your design on paper. This will help you visualize the pattern and make sure it fits your lawn.
  • Use Markers: If you're having trouble keeping your lines straight, use markers like stakes or flags to guide you.
  • Maintain Your Lawnmower: A dull lawnmower blade will make it harder to create clean and crisp lines. Make sure you sharpen your blade regularly.
  • Experiment: Don't be afraid to try new patterns and techniques. The more you experiment, the more creative you can get.
